Working with JavaFX Charts

This tutorial describes the graphical charts available in the javafx.scene.chart package of the JavaFX SDK and contains the following chapters:

  • Pie Chart

    Describes a chart that represents data in a form of circle divided into triangular wedges called slices.

  • Line Chart

    Describes the line chart, a type of two-axis chart that presents data as a series of points connected by straight lines

  • Area Chart

    Describes the area chart that presents data as an area between a series of points connected by straight lines and the axis.

  • Bubble Chart

    Describes the bubble chart, a two-axis chart that plots bubbles for the data points in a series.

  • Scatter Chart

    Describes the scatter chart, a two-axis chart that presents its data as a set of points.

  • Bar Chart

    Describes the bar chart, a two-axis chart that presents discrete data with rectangular bars.

Each chapter provides code samples and applications to illustrate how to use a particular chart. You can find the source files of the applications and the corresponding NetBeans projects in the Chart Samples appendix.
